Managing new pages permissions

The New Pages category in the Permission Group dialog box lets you specify whether users can create new, blank pages, create duplicate pages by copying the current page, as well as determine what Dreamweaver templates users are able to see and use.

When specifying the new page types that users are able to create, carefully consider the look and feel of the web site. In many cases, it will be best to constrain users to use either copies of existing pages, or, if they are available, to use only Dreamweaver templates.

permissions for new pages

Contribute lets you control the types of new pages that users can create, and lets you specify templates that users can use to create new pages. The new page types include the following:

  • Create a blank page lets users create blank pages.
  • Use built-in sample pages lets users create and modify copies of preexisting sample pages that are provided with Contribute.
  • Create a new page by copying any page on the web site lets users create and modify a copy of an existing page on the web site.
  • Create a new page by copying a page from this list lets users create pages based on a set of pages that you specify.
  • Use Dreamweaver templates lets users create pages based on templates created in Dreamweaver, usually by a site developer, that have defined editable and non-editable regions. Such pages ensure a consistent look and feel throughout a web site, and only allow users to update specific areas of text and images.

Specifying Dreamweaver templates for contributors to use

Contribute lets you choose what Dreamweaver templates users are able to see and use to create new web pages. You can choose to let users see all of the available templates, or only templates that you choose for users of that group.

To specify the Dreamweaver templates users can see and use:

  1. In the New Pages category of the Permission Group dialog box, select Use Dreamweaver templates and select one of the following:
    • Show users all templates allows users to see all of the available templates.
    • Only show users these templates displays only certain templates to users. If you select this option, you can select templates and use the Hide and Show buttons to move the templates between the Hidden templates list and the Only show users these templates list.
  2. Repeat until all of the templates you want to display to users of the group are visible in the Only show users these templates list.
